Why use an SMS gateway instead of WhatsApp for bulk outreach?
WhatsApp needs a smartphone and data. Roughly 15% of MTN South Africa customers still sit on 2G feature phones, and many more have smartphones but run out of data. SMS lands on every handset that can receive a text. Use WhatsApp for rich conversations; use a bulk SMS gateway when reach matters more than media.
How much does a bulk SMS cost in South Africa?
Local gateways typically charge about R0.12–R0.34 per SMS on a volume sliding scale (SMSPortal often from around R0.18; mid-volume bundles commonly land near R0.20–R0.28 excl. VAT). Twilio's published outbound rate to South African mobiles is about $0.1355 per segment, roughly R2.20–R2.40 at recent Rand rates, so most SA mid-market teams prefer a local SMS gateway for mass SMS sending.
What are POPIA rules for marketing SMS?
POPIA section 69 restricts direct marketing by SMS unless the person has given consent or is an existing customer under the Act's conditions. The Information Regulator's guidance and the 2025 regulation amendments make clear that an opt-out alone is not consent for cold electronic marketing. Every marketing SMS should carry an easy unsubscribe path, and consent source and timestamp should live in the CRM that triggers the send.
Why do delivery reports (DLRs) matter?
A DLR is the carrier receipt that says delivered, failed, expired, or rejected. Without it you pay gateway credits for numbers that never rang. Industry guidance treats delivery above 95% as healthy; dirty lists often sit closer to the low nineties. Wiring DLRs back to the CRM lets you purge dead numbers and stop burning budget on undeliverable traffic.
